Francesco Nutini is a scholar working on Ecology, Global and Planetary Change and Environmental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Francesco Nutini has authored 24 papers receiving a total of 795 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 14 papers in Ecology, 10 papers in Global and Planetary Change and 8 papers in Environmental Engineering. Recurrent topics in Francesco Nutini’s work include Remote Sensing in Agriculture (14 papers), Land Use and Ecosystem Services (6 papers) and Leaf Properties and Growth Measurement (4 papers). Francesco Nutini is often cited by papers focused on Remote Sensing in Agriculture (14 papers), Land Use and Ecosystem Services (6 papers) and Leaf Properties and Growth Measurement (4 papers). Francesco Nutini collaborates with scholars based in Italy, Spain and Philippines. Francesco Nutini's co-authors include Mirco Boschetti, Pietro Alessandro Brivio, Andrew Nelson, Giacinto Manfron, Alberto Crema, Lorenzo Busetto, Luigi Ranghetti, Gustau Camps‐Valls, Francisco Javier Garcı́a-Haro and Manuel Campos‐Taberner and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Remote Sensing of Environment and Sensors.
